
Crunchyroll reduces the subscription plan for Indian Otakus.
Crunchyroll has announced a reduction in its plan for Indian anime viewers. The announcement was made, seeing the big craze for anime among Indian viewers. Crunchyroll has a library of around 5500 anime episodes with 1000 hours in English dub. It has recently dubbed two anime in Hindi, My Dress Up Darling and Ranking of Kings, with more coming on the way.
Crunchyroll has expanded its plan to 100 countries, and India is among them. It will offer plans of Rs. 79 for ordinary fan membership and Rs.99 for Mega fan membership(4 screens). It can stream both Hindi and English anime. The mega fan costs Rs. 999/year.
Regarding Crunchyroll’s updated subscription strategy and aspirations to this time effectively approach the Indian market, its president, Rahul Purini, said the following: “There is a massive appetite for anime in India with a growing number of fans who are craving more of what they love. Our team has worked hard to expand our service — including more content and more dubs, at a more affordable price.”
